(1) Keep the surface of the receiving chamber clean. The receiving chamber is in direct contact with the skin. If the surface of the receiving chamber is not cleaned for a long time, it will increase the risk of residual limb infection. Users should regularly clean their residual limbs, wipe the inner wall of the receiving chamber frequently, and maintain dryness and cleanliness. The internal receiving cavity (soft receiving cavity) of the calf prosthesis can be cleaned with warm water, and the water temperature should not be too hot to avoid deformation. Correctly select and clean residual limb socks, choose cotton or wool residual limb socks with good water absorption, and regularly wash the socks with alkaline soap. Limb socks should be changed at least once a day, and even more frequently when sweating. (2) When there is an injury to the residual limb, especially the lower limbs, the use of prosthetics should be stopped, because the wound on the residual limb is difficult to heal when using lower limb prosthetics to bear weight, often causing the wound to gradually enlarge and cause infection, resulting in long-term inability to wear prosthetics. Therefore, minor injuries should also be treated seriously and promptly cured. During the treatment of residual limb wounds, patients should be guided to make a decision not to wear prostheses and to repair the parts that are not compatible with the receiving cavity to prevent the wound from recurring. In addition, when abnormalities such as eczema, blisters, cysts, tinea albuginea, dermatitis, and discoloration and swelling of the residual limb skin are found, timely symptomatic treatment should be given to prevent infection.
(3) Regular attention should be paid to whether there are small cracks on the upper edge of the receiving cavity, and timely detection and repair by a prosthetic technician can prolong the service life of the prosthetic.

(4) Regularly pay attention to whether there is any abnormal noise from the prosthetic while walking. If it is found, it indicates that some joint components or joints are damaged or loose, and should be repaired in a timely manner.

(5) Plastic parts in prosthetic structures should not come into contact with acid, alkali, fire, colored solutions, or hard foreign objects to prevent corrosion, staining, melting, and cracking.

(6) Decorative jackets are prone to breakage. If users find small damages, they can repair them to extend their service life.

(7) When changing shoes for lower limb prosthetics, pay attention to the height of the heel of the shoe and do not wear shoes with different heel heights, because the alignment of the lower limb prosthesis is directly related to the heel height of the shoes worn by the amputee. If shoes with different heel heights are worn compared to those designed during the production of prosthetics, it can cause improper alignment of the prosthetic, leading to knee flexion or buckling.
(8) The outer packaging and footboard of lower limb prostheses should be waterproof. In case of accidental water sticking, the socks and shoes should be changed immediately, and wet areas should be dried with a hair dryer before use.

(9) For the electrical and precision mechanical systems in prosthetic structures, moisture, impact, and dirt should be avoided, and professional personnel should be regularly consulted for inspection and maintenance.

(10) Regular inspection and maintenance: Generally, a comprehensive inspection and maintenance of the prosthetic should be carried out at the prosthetic manufacturing institution every six months or one year, which is important for extending the service life of the prosthetic.
